Abraham Rivera, aged 52, passed away on April 8, 2025. He is survived by his wife, Adriana Korb, his mother, Madeline Liu, and his father, Abraham Rivera and stepfather, Zayd Khaliq. Mr. Rivera was a family member remembered by many relatives and friends.
Since 2019, Mr. Rivera served as the Incident Commander for New York City's Cyber Command. His career encompasses consultancy leadership roles at Bristol-Myers Squibb, Deutsche Bank, Barclays Investment Bank, and Morgan Stanley. Additionally, he held the position of Executive of IT and Investigative Operations and served as a peace officer with the NYC Department of Investigation. In academia, he worked as Adjunct Lecturer at John Jay College and Bronx Community College, teaching courses in Digital Forensics, Cybersecurity, and Public Administration. He also founded and managed Watchdog Forensics, LLC, a firm specializing in forensic investigations.
Mr. Rivera earned widespread respect for his dedication, intelligence, humor, and leadership. He graduated Cum Laude from City College of New York and obtained a Master's in Public Administration from John Jay College.
Mr. Rivera, born on December 29, 1972, in the Bronx NY, deeply valued his city, friends, family, and pets: Tango Whiskey, and Baby. He appreciated music and film, enjoyed celebrating others, and had a distinctive sense of fashion, consistently serving as a positive role model.
